Transaction 16c4a4d36a25f51ac88f5913ce8bebb3da9d0b69010ed709434ee0a4cc40e048
1 Input
1 Output
-
16c4a4d36a25f51ac88f5913ce8bebb3da9d0b69010ed709434ee0a4cc40e048:0
- value
- 26995
- script pubkey
- OP_0 OP_PUSHBYTES_20 8224c5a60641fda780dd06e54ce1ea65e563614c
- address
- bc1qsgjvtfsxg8760qxaqmj5ec02vhjkxc2vtfyuzw